Selden<\/span><\/figcaption><\/figure>\n\n\n\n<p class=\"has-cm-color-6-color has-text-color has-link-color has-medium-font-size wp-elements-c5c8bfbef16787218e24df6db6cdef77 wp-block-paragraph\">Em ess\u00eancia, um f\u00f3ssil \u00e9 qualquer vest\u00edgio preservado de um ser vivo antigo. Pode ser um osso, uma concha, uma folha ou at\u00e9 mesmo uma pegada. H\u00e1 tamb\u00e9m f\u00f3sseis microsc\u00f3picos, invis\u00edveis a olho nu, mas cruciais para a ci\u00eancia. Contudo, nem todo organismo deixa marcas. <\/p>\n\n\n\n<p class=\"has-cm-color-6-color has-text-color has-link-color has-medium-font-size wp-elements-19881fde7b61397d2b49edc504aecf8e wp-block-paragraph\">Existem diferentes tipos de f\u00f3sseis. Os f\u00f3sseis corporais registram partes do organismo, como conchas e ossos. J\u00e1 os f\u00f3sseis icnol\u00f3gicos revelam atividades, como rastros e tocas. Tamb\u00e9m existem f\u00f3sseis qu\u00edmicos, que preservam mol\u00e9culas ou pigmentos.  <\/p>\n\n\n\n<p class=\"has-cm-color-6-color has-text-color has-link-color has-medium-font-size wp-elements-f967c06f59be573476b7e18e6314879d wp-block-paragraph\">Al\u00e9m disso, algumas formas de preserva\u00e7\u00e3o, como organismos aprisionados em \u00e2mbar, oferecem detalhes t\u00e3o finos que revelam pelos, asas e at\u00e9 colora\u00e7\u00f5es originais. Desse modo, cada categoria fornece informa\u00e7\u00f5es complementares. Gra\u00e7as a essa diversidade, a paleontologia pode reconstruir ecossistemas inteiros.<\/p>\n\n\n\n<p class=\"has-cm-color-6-color has-text-color has-link-color has-medium-font-size wp-elements-062985e93d7b110e5e8d19a67d9d5ec1 wp-block-paragraph\">O processo de fossiliza\u00e7\u00e3o \u00e9 raro e depende de condi\u00e7\u00f5es espec\u00edficas. O soterramento r\u00e1pido protege os restos da decomposi\u00e7\u00e3o, enquanto minerais substituem ou preenchem tecidos, garantindo sua preserva\u00e7\u00e3o ao longo de milhares ou milh\u00f5es de anos.<\/p>\n\n\n\n<h2 class=\"wp-block-heading\"><span><strong style=\"color: rgb(0, 0, 0); font-family: &quot;courier new&quot;, courier, monospace; font-size: 14pt; font-weight: bold;\">A import\u00e2ncia cient\u00edfica dos f\u00f3sseis <\/strong><\/span><\/h2>\n\n\n\n<figure class=\"wp-block-image aligncenter size-full\"><a href=\"http:\/\/biologo.com.br\/bio\/expedicao-paleontologica\/\"><img data-recalc-dims=\"1\" loading=\"lazy\" decoding=\"async\" width=\"631\" height=\"351\" data-attachment-id=\"3181\" data-permalink=\"https:\/\/biologo.com.br\/bio\/expedicao-paleontologica\/expedicao-paleontologica\/\" data-orig-file=\"https:\/\/i0.wp.com\/biologo.com.br\/bio\/wp-content\/uploads\/2017\/10\/Expedi%C3%A7%C3%A3o-paleontol%C3%B3gica.jpg?fit=631%2C351&amp;ssl=1\" data-orig-size=\"631,351\" data-comments-opened=\"0\" data-image-meta=\"{&quot;aperture&quot;:&quot;0&quot;,&quot;credit&quot;:&quot;&quot;,&quot;camera&quot;:&quot;&quot;,&quot;caption&quot;:&quot;&quot;,&quot;created_timestamp&quot;:&quot;0&quot;,&quot;copyright&quot;:&quot;&quot;,&quot;focal_length&quot;:&quot;0&quot;,&quot;iso&quot;:&quot;0&quot;,&quot;shutter_speed&quot;:&quot;0&quot;,&quot;title&quot;:&quot;&quot;,&quot;orientation&quot;:&quot;0&quot;}\" data-image-title=\"Expedi\u00e7\u00e3o-paleontol\u00f3gica\" data-image-description=\"&lt;p&gt;Expedi\u00e7\u00e3o paleontol\u00f3gica&lt;\/p&gt;\n\" data-image-caption=\"&lt;p&gt;Expedi\u00e7\u00e3o paleontol\u00f3gica. fonte: Youtube.com&lt;\/p&gt;\n\" data-large-file=\"https:\/\/i0.wp.com\/biologo.com.br\/bio\/wp-content\/uploads\/2017\/10\/Expedi%C3%A7%C3%A3o-paleontol%C3%B3gica.jpg?fit=631%2C351&amp;ssl=1\" src=\"https:\/\/i0.wp.com\/biologo.com.br\/bio\/wp-content\/uploads\/2017\/10\/Expedi%C3%A7%C3%A3o-paleontol%C3%B3gica.jpg?resize=631%2C351&#038;ssl=1\" alt=\"Expedi\u00e7\u00e3o paleontol\u00f3gica\" class=\"wp-image-3181\" srcset=\"https:\/\/i0.wp.com\/biologo.com.br\/bio\/wp-content\/uploads\/2017\/10\/Expedi%C3%A7%C3%A3o-paleontol%C3%B3gica.jpg?w=631&amp;ssl=1 631w, https:\/\/i0.wp.com\/biologo.com.br\/bio\/wp-content\/uploads\/2017\/10\/Expedi%C3%A7%C3%A3o-paleontol%C3%B3gica.jpg?resize=300%2C167&amp;ssl=1 300w\" sizes=\"auto, (max-width: 631px) 100vw, 631px\" \/><\/a><figcaption class=\"wp-element-caption\"><span style=\"color: #000000;\"><span style=\"font-size: 10pt;\"><strong><a style=\"color: #000000;\" href=\"http:\/\/biologo.com.br\/bio\/expedicao-paleontologica\/\">Expedi\u00e7\u00e3o paleontol\u00f3gica<\/a><\/strong><\/span><span style=\"font-size: 8pt;\">. fonte: Youtube.com<\/span><\/span><\/figcaption><\/figure>\n\n\n\n<p class=\"has-cm-color-6-color has-text-color has-link-color has-medium-font-size wp-elements-7fdef534d5a1f8efe80157a167082ab7 wp-block-paragraph\">A relev\u00e2ncia dos f\u00f3sseis vai muito al\u00e9m da simples curiosidade. Eles s\u00e3o as melhores evid\u00eancias da evolu\u00e7\u00e3o biol\u00f3gica, pois registram mudan\u00e7as anat\u00f4micas graduais. Gra\u00e7as a eles, foi poss\u00edvel compreender a transi\u00e7\u00e3o de peixes para anf\u00edbios (Clack, 2002) e confirmar a origem das aves a partir dos dinossauros (Chiappe, 2009). Ao mesmo tempo, permitem acompanhar trajet\u00f3rias de extin\u00e7\u00e3o e surgimento de novas linhagens. Assim, revelam o car\u00e1ter din\u00e2mico da vida ao longo do tempo profundo.<\/p>\n\n\n\n<blockquote class=\"wp-block-quote is-layout-flow wp-block-quote-is-layout-flow\" style=\"border-radius:100px\">\n<p class=\"has-medium-font-size wp-block-paragraph\"><strong>\u201cF\u00f3sseis s\u00e3o as p\u00e1ginas de pedra que contam a hist\u00f3ria da vida.\u201d<\/strong><br>\u2014 <a href=\"https:\/\/biologo.com.br\/bio\/stephen-jay-gould\/\"><span style=\"text-decoration: underline;\">Stephen Jay Gould<\/span><\/a>, paleont\u00f3logo.<\/p>\n<\/blockquote>\n\n\n\n<figure class=\"wp-block-image aligncenter size-full\"><a href=\"http:\/\/biologo.com.br\/bio\/micropaleontologia\/\"><img data-recalc-dims=\"1\" loading=\"lazy\" decoding=\"async\" width=\"415\" height=\"286\" data-attachment-id=\"3218\" data-permalink=\"https:\/\/biologo.com.br\/bio\/micropaleontologia\/micropaleontologia-foraminiferos\/\" data-orig-file=\"https:\/\/i0.wp.com\/biologo.com.br\/bio\/wp-content\/uploads\/2017\/11\/Micropaleontologia-foramin%C3%ADferos.jpg?fit=415%2C286&amp;ssl=1\" data-orig-size=\"415,286\" data-comments-opened=\"0\" data-image-meta=\"{&quot;aperture&quot;:&quot;0&quot;,&quot;credit&quot;:&quot;&quot;,&quot;camera&quot;:&quot;&quot;,&quot;caption&quot;:&quot;&quot;,&quot;created_timestamp&quot;:&quot;0&quot;,&quot;copyright&quot;:&quot;&quot;,&quot;focal_length&quot;:&quot;0&quot;,&quot;iso&quot;:&quot;0&quot;,&quot;shutter_speed&quot;:&quot;0&quot;,&quot;title&quot;:&quot;&quot;,&quot;orientation&quot;:&quot;0&quot;}\" data-image-title=\"Micropaleontologia-foramin\u00edferos\" data-image-description=\"&lt;p&gt;Foramin\u00edferos f\u00f3sseis dos Emirados \u00c1rabes; escala em mm.&lt;\/p&gt;\n\" data-image-caption=\"&lt;p&gt;Micropaleontologia. Foramin\u00edferos f\u00f3sseis dos Emirados \u00c1rabes&lt;\/p&gt;\n\" data-large-file=\"https:\/\/i0.wp.com\/biologo.com.br\/bio\/wp-content\/uploads\/2017\/11\/Micropaleontologia-foramin%C3%ADferos.jpg?fit=415%2C286&amp;ssl=1\" src=\"https:\/\/i0.wp.com\/biologo.com.br\/bio\/wp-content\/uploads\/2017\/11\/Micropaleontologia-foramin%C3%ADferos.jpg?resize=415%2C286&#038;ssl=1\" alt=\"Foramin\u00edferos f\u00f3sseis dos Emirados \u00c1rabes\" class=\"wp-image-3218\" srcset=\"https:\/\/i0.wp.com\/biologo.com.br\/bio\/wp-content\/uploads\/2017\/11\/Micropaleontologia-foramin%C3%ADferos.jpg?w=415&amp;ssl=1 415w, https:\/\/i0.wp.com\/biologo.com.br\/bio\/wp-content\/uploads\/2017\/11\/Micropaleontologia-foramin%C3%ADferos.jpg?resize=300%2C207&amp;ssl=1 300w, https:\/\/i0.wp.com\/biologo.com.br\/bio\/wp-content\/uploads\/2017\/11\/Micropaleontologia-foramin%C3%ADferos.jpg?resize=130%2C90&amp;ssl=1 130w\" sizes=\"auto, (max-width: 415px) 100vw, 415px\" \/><\/a><figcaption class=\"wp-element-caption\"><strong><span style=\"color: #000000; font-size: 10pt;\"><a style=\"color: #000000;\" href=\"http:\/\/biologo.com.br\/bio\/micropaleontologia\/\">Micropaleontologia<\/a><\/span><\/strong><span style=\"font-size: 8pt; color: #000000;\"><strong><span style=\"font-size: 10pt;\">. <\/span><\/strong>Foramin\u00edferos f\u00f3sseis dos Emirados \u00c1rabes<\/span><\/figcaption><\/figure>\n\n\n\n<p class=\"has-cm-color-6-color has-text-color has-link-color has-medium-font-size wp-elements-ca76f60774e4cba1bcdd7ace7fbfd880 wp-block-paragraph\">Os f\u00f3sseis tamb\u00e9m auxiliam a organizar o tempo geol\u00f3gico. Certas esp\u00e9cies viveram apenas em per\u00edodos restritos e, por isso, funcionam como f\u00f3sseis-guia. Eles permitem correlacionar camadas de rochas em diferentes regi\u00f5es e, consequentemente, estabelecer uma escala cronol\u00f3gica global (Gradstein et al., 2020). Al\u00e9m disso, fornecem ind\u00edcios sobre ambientes passados.<\/p>\n\n\n\n<p class=\"has-cm-color-6-color has-text-color has-link-color has-medium-font-size wp-elements-09097d17d91731139d6b6b500fbf70dd wp-block-paragraph\">Restos vegetais revelam condi\u00e7\u00f5es clim\u00e1ticas antigas, conchas marinhas indicam a posi\u00e7\u00e3o de mares extintos e <a href=\"https:\/\/biologo.com.br\/bio\/micropaleontologia\/\"><span style=\"text-decoration: underline;\">microf\u00f3sseis<\/span><\/a> ajudam a reconstruir temperaturas oce\u00e2nicas (Zachos et al., 2008). Desse modo, os f\u00f3sseis conectam biologia e clima em um mesmo registro material.<\/p>\n\n\n\n<figure class=\"wp-block-image aligncenter size-full\"><a href=\"https:\/\/i0.wp.com\/biologo.com.br\/bio\/wp-content\/uploads\/2016\/07\/paleobotanica.jpg?ssl=1\"><img data-recalc-dims=\"1\" loading=\"lazy\" decoding=\"async\" width=\"631\" height=\"351\" data-attachment-id=\"848\" data-permalink=\"https:\/\/biologo.com.br\/bio\/paleobotanica\/paleobotanica-2\/\" data-orig-file=\"https:\/\/i0.wp.com\/biologo.com.br\/bio\/wp-content\/uploads\/2016\/07\/paleobotanica.jpg?fit=631%2C351&amp;ssl=1\" data-orig-size=\"631,351\" data-comments-opened=\"0\" data-image-meta=\"{&quot;aperture&quot;:&quot;0&quot;,&quot;credit&quot;:&quot;&quot;,&quot;camera&quot;:&quot;&quot;,&quot;caption&quot;:&quot;&quot;,&quot;created_timestamp&quot;:&quot;0&quot;,&quot;copyright&quot;:&quot;&quot;,&quot;focal_length&quot;:&quot;0&quot;,&quot;iso&quot;:&quot;0&quot;,&quot;shutter_speed&quot;:&quot;0&quot;,&quot;title&quot;:&quot;&quot;,&quot;orientation&quot;:&quot;0&quot;}\" data-image-title=\"paleobotanica\" data-image-description=\"&lt;p&gt;Um f\u00f3ssil da folha da faia Europeia (Fagus sylvatica) do Plioceno da Fran\u00e7a, cerca de 3 milh\u00f5es de anos atr\u00e1s. Esses gigantes pr\u00e9-hist\u00f3ricos mudaram radicalmente a vis\u00e3o sobre o passado. Desde ent\u00e3o, cada nova descoberta ampliou horizontes. Um exemplo emblem\u00e1tico foi o <em>Archaeopteryx<\/em>, encontrado em 1861, que apresentou penas preservadas com perfei\u00e7\u00e3o e comprovou a liga\u00e7\u00e3o entre aves e dinossauros.<\/p>\n\n\n\n<p class=\"has-cm-color-6-color has-text-color has-link-color has-medium-font-size wp-elements-9c01945652822c25ab9ee3063e6278e8 wp-block-paragraph\">Outro marco foi a descoberta de Lucy, pertencente a <em>Australopithecus afarensis<\/em>. Esse f\u00f3ssil revelou a import\u00e2ncia do bipedalismo no in\u00edcio da evolu\u00e7\u00e3o humana (Johanson &amp; Edey, 1981). Da mesma forma, f\u00f3sseis de Neandertais mostraram a diversidade da linhagem humana e a proximidade de nossa esp\u00e9cie com outros homin\u00eddeos.<\/p>\n\n\n\n<figure class=\"wp-block-image aligncenter wp-image-128\"><img data-recalc-dims=\"1\" loading=\"lazy\" decoding=\"async\" width=\"800\" height=\"359\" data-attachment-id=\"128\" data-permalink=\"https:\/\/biologo.com.br\/bio\/fosseis\/8706710957_26d97fb206_z-2\/\" data-orig-file=\"https:\/\/i0.wp.com\/biologo.com.br\/bio\/wp-content\/uploads\/2015\/10\/8706710957_26d97fb206_z1.jpg?fit=800%2C359&amp;ssl=1\" data-orig-size=\"800,359\" data-comments-opened=\"1\" data-image-meta=\"{&quot;aperture&quot;:&quot;0&quot;,&quot;credit&quot;:&quot;&quot;,&quot;camera&quot;:&quot;&quot;,&quot;caption&quot;:&quot;&quot;,&quot;created_timestamp&quot;:&quot;0&quot;,&quot;copyright&quot;:&quot;&quot;,&quot;focal_length&quot;:&quot;0&quot;,&quot;iso&quot;:&quot;0&quot;,&quot;shutter_speed&quot;:&quot;0&quot;,&quot;title&quot;:&quot;&quot;,&quot;orientation&quot;:&quot;0&quot;}\" data-image-title=\"\u00e2mbar\" data-image-description=\"&lt;p&gt;Inseto preservado em \u00e2mbar&lt;\/p&gt;\n\" data-image-caption=\"&lt;p&gt;Inseto preservado em \u00e2mbar. foto: Adrian Pingstone&lt;\/p&gt;\n\" data-large-file=\"https:\/\/i0.wp.com\/biologo.com.br\/bio\/wp-content\/uploads\/2015\/10\/8706710957_26d97fb206_z1.jpg?fit=800%2C359&amp;ssl=1\" src=\"https:\/\/i0.wp.com\/biologo.com.br\/bio\/wp-content\/uploads\/2015\/10\/8706710957_26d97fb206_z1.jpg?resize=800%2C359\" alt=\"Inseto preservado em \u00e2mbar\" class=\"wp-image-128\" srcset=\"https:\/\/i0.wp.com\/biologo.com.br\/bio\/wp-content\/uploads\/2015\/10\/8706710957_26d97fb206_z1.jpg?w=800&amp;ssl=1 800w, https:\/\/i0.wp.com\/biologo.com.br\/bio\/wp-content\/uploads\/2015\/10\/8706710957_26d97fb206_z1.jpg?resize=300%2C135&amp;ssl=1 300w\" sizes=\"auto, (max-width: 800px) 100vw, 800px\" \/><figcaption class=\"wp-element-caption\"><span style=\"color: #000000;\"><span style=\"font-size: 10pt;\">Inseto preservado em \u00e2mbar<strong>.<\/strong><\/span><span style=\"font-size: 8pt;\"> foto: Adrian Pingstone<\/span><\/span><\/figcaption><\/figure>\n\n\n\n<p class=\"has-cm-color-6-color has-text-color has-link-color has-medium-font-size wp-elements-cd132db179103247e9136861f872a9c7 wp-block-paragraph\">Com o avan\u00e7o da tecnologia, a paleontologia ganhou novas ferramentas. A microscopia eletr\u00f4nica permitiu observar detalhes celulares fossilizados. O sequenciamento de DNA antigo forneceu informa\u00e7\u00f5es gen\u00e9ticas de esp\u00e9cies extintas, como mamutes e neandertais (P\u00e4\u00e4bo, 2014). Al\u00e9m disso, f\u00f3sseis de dinossauros com penas coloridas transformaram a forma de imagin\u00e1-los, revelando animais vibrantes e din\u00e2micos. Assim, cada achado redefine paradigmas e refor\u00e7a o car\u00e1ter din\u00e2mico dessa ci\u00eancia.<span style=\"color: #000000;\"> <\/span><\/p>\n\n\n\n<h4 class=\"wp-block-heading\"><span style=\"color: #000000; font-family: 'courier new', courier, monospace;\"><strong><span style=\"font-size: 12pt;\"><span><strong style=\"color: rgb(0, 0, 0); font-family: &quot;courier new&quot;, courier, monospace; font-size: 14pt; font-weight: bold;\">F\u00f3sseis, extin\u00e7\u00f5es e o futuro da ci\u00eancia <\/strong><\/span><\/span><\/strong><\/span><\/h4>\n\n\n\n<p class=\"has-cm-color-6-color has-text-color has-link-color has-medium-font-size wp-elements-566a418bbf1cd53b541f6f541455e515 wp-block-paragraph\">Embora revelem o passado, f\u00f3sseis ajudam a compreender o presente e planejar o futuro. Eles documentam eventos de extin\u00e7\u00e3o em massa e mostram como esp\u00e9cies reagiram a mudan\u00e7as ambientais dr\u00e1sticas. Dessa forma, oferecem paralelos \u00fateis para avaliar a crise de biodiversidade atual (Barnosky et al., 2011).<\/p>\n\n\n\n<figure class=\"wp-block-image aligncenter size-full has-custom-border\"><a href=\"http:\/\/biologo.com.br\/bio\/documentarios-de-evolucao-e-paleontologia\/\"><img data-recalc-dims=\"1\" loading=\"lazy\" decoding=\"async\" width=\"631\" height=\"351\" data-attachment-id=\"2750\" data-permalink=\"https:\/\/biologo.com.br\/bio\/documentarios-de-evolucao-e-paleontologia\/documentarios-de-evolucao-e-paleontologia-2\/\" data-orig-file=\"https:\/\/i0.wp.com\/biologo.com.br\/bio\/wp-content\/uploads\/2017\/08\/Document%C3%A1rios-de-Evolu%C3%A7%C3%A3o-e-Paleontologia.jpg?fit=631%2C351&amp;ssl=1\" data-orig-size=\"631,351\" data-comments-opened=\"0\" data-image-meta=\"{&quot;aperture&quot;:&quot;0&quot;,&quot;credit&quot;:&quot;&quot;,&quot;camera&quot;:&quot;&quot;,&quot;caption&quot;:&quot;&quot;,&quot;created_timestamp&quot;:&quot;0&quot;,&quot;copyright&quot;:&quot;&quot;,&quot;focal_length&quot;:&quot;0&quot;,&quot;iso&quot;:&quot;0&quot;,&quot;shutter_speed&quot;:&quot;0&quot;,&quot;title&quot;:&quot;&quot;,&quot;orientation&quot;:&quot;0&quot;}\" data-image-title=\"Document\u00e1rios-de-Evolu\u00e7\u00e3o-e-Paleontologia\" data-image-description=\"&lt;p&gt;Document\u00e1rios de Evolu\u00e7\u00e3o e Paleontologia&lt;\/p&gt;\n\" data-image-caption=\"&lt;p&gt;Document\u00e1rios de Evolu\u00e7\u00e3o e Paleontologia&lt;\/p&gt;\n\" data-large-file=\"https:\/\/i0.wp.com\/biologo.com.br\/bio\/wp-content\/uploads\/2017\/08\/Document%C3%A1rios-de-Evolu%C3%A7%C3%A3o-e-Paleontologia.jpg?fit=631%2C351&amp;ssl=1\" src=\"https:\/\/i0.wp.com\/biologo.com.br\/bio\/wp-content\/uploads\/2017\/08\/Document%C3%A1rios-de-Evolu%C3%A7%C3%A3o-e-Paleontologia.jpg?resize=631%2C351&#038;ssl=1\" alt=\"Document\u00e1rios de Evolu\u00e7\u00e3o e Paleontologia\" class=\"wp-image-2750\" style=\"border-radius:33px\" srcset=\"https:\/\/i0.wp.com\/biologo.com.br\/bio\/wp-content\/uploads\/2017\/08\/Document%C3%A1rios-de-Evolu%C3%A7%C3%A3o-e-Paleontologia.jpg?w=631&amp;ssl=1 631w, https:\/\/i0.wp.com\/biologo.com.br\/bio\/wp-content\/uploads\/2017\/08\/Document%C3%A1rios-de-Evolu%C3%A7%C3%A3o-e-Paleontologia.jpg?resize=300%2C167&amp;ssl=1 300w\" sizes=\"auto, (max-width: 631px) 100vw, 631px\" \/><\/a><figcaption class=\"wp-element-caption\"><a href=\"http:\/\/biologo.com.br\/bio\/documentarios-de-evolucao-e-paleontologia\/\"><span style=\"color: #000000;\"><strong><span style=\"font-size: 10pt;\">Document\u00e1rios de Evolu\u00e7\u00e3o e Paleontologia<\/span><\/strong><\/span><\/a><\/figcaption><\/figure>\n\n\n\n<p class=\"has-cm-color-6-color has-text-color has-link-color has-medium-font-size wp-elements-22862a573bdc8d6a66f7facb57505f82 wp-block-paragraph\">Al\u00e9m disso, a paleontologia tornou-se cada vez mais interdisciplinar.
